205 a Ocean Ave, Melbourne Beach, FL 32951Nautical Cafe in Melbourne Beach has accumulated 88 violations across 26 inspections since 2016, averaging 3.4 per visit. The facility has not been shut down and faces no fire safety violations. The most frequently cited issues involve food contact surfaces, approved food sources, and toilet facilities. In 2023, the cafe received a warning and three consecutive callback inspections, all of which were resolved with compliance.
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
